On Indian Lake
By Charles L. O’Donnell
 
APPLE trees on a low hill
  And the dead sun behind;
The water red and still;
  No sound, no wind.
 
Sudden the booming flight        5
  Of coots upstirred;
Overhead, in the early night,
  The moon, white bird.
